+SCM_DEFINE (scm_make_soft_port, "make-soft-port", 2, 0, 0,
+ (SCM pv, SCM modes),
+ "Return a port capable of receiving or delivering characters as\n"
+ "specified by the @var{modes} string (@pxref{File Ports,\n"
+ "open-file}). @var{pv} must be a vector of length 5 or 6. Its\n"
+ "components are as follows:\n"
+ "\n"
+ "@enumerate 0\n"
+ "@item\n"
+ "procedure accepting one character for output\n"
+ "@item\n"
+ "procedure accepting a string for output\n"
+ "@item\n"
+ "thunk for flushing output\n"
+ "@item\n"
+ "thunk for getting one character\n"
+ "@item\n"
+ "thunk for closing port (not by garbage collection)\n"
+ "@item\n"
+ "(if present and not @code{#f}) thunk for computing the number of\n"
+ "characters that can be read from the port without blocking.\n"
+ "@end enumerate\n"
+ "\n"
+ "For an output-only port only elements 0, 1, 2, and 4 need be\n"
+ "procedures. For an input-only port only elements 3 and 4 need\n"
+ "be procedures. Thunks 2 and 4 can instead be @code{#f} if\n"
+ "there is no useful operation for them to perform.\n"
+ "\n"
+ "If thunk 3 returns @code{#f} or an @code{eof-object}\n"
+ "(@pxref{Input, eof-object?, ,r5rs, The Revised^5 Report on\n"
+ "Scheme}) it indicates that the port has reached end-of-file.\n"
+ "For example:\n"
+ "\n"
+ "@lisp\n"
+ "(define stdout (current-output-port))\n"
+ "(define p (make-soft-port\n"
+ " (vector\n"
+ " (lambda (c) (write c stdout))\n"
+ " (lambda (s) (display s stdout))\n"
+ " (lambda () (display \".\" stdout))\n"
+ " (lambda () (char-upcase (read-char)))\n"
+ " (lambda () (display \"@@\" stdout)))\n"
+ " \"rw\"))\n"
+ "\n"
+ "(write p p) @result{} #<input-output: soft 8081e20>\n"
+ "@end lisp")
